What is a cause list?

A cause list is the official daily schedule of court hearings published by HM Courts & Tribunals Service (HMCTS). It shows which cases are listed for each day, at what time, in which courtroom, and before which judge. Where can I find sentencing results for Bournemouth Combined Court?

CauseAlert shows scheduled hearings at Bournemouth Combined Court, including cases listed "for Sentence". However, sentencing outcomes are not published through HMCTS cause lists. For Crown Court sentencing remarks, check the Judiciary website at judiciary.uk. For recent cases, local news coverage is often the fastest source of results.

Are court records at Bournemouth Combined Court public?

Daily cause lists published by HMCTS are public documents. CauseAlert mirrors every published listing for Bournemouth Combined Court. For historical case records beyond cause lists, contact the court directly or search court judgments on the National Archives.
